Conor McGregor features in HITMAN World of Assassination as The Disruptor, a multimillionaire MMA Fighter with worldwide fame who started a feud with the CEO of a prominent tech company, putting a target on his back in the process. The Disruptor mission is available globally on PlayStation®5, PlayStation®4, Xbox Series X|S, Xbox One consoles, Nintendo Switch™, and PC, starting today, Thursday, June 27th, to Monday, July 29th.

Hitman 1 was episodic - and really well suited to it, I remember spending 20+ hours on a single level while waiting for the next one.

This is Hitman 3, which has its own complete campaign plus you can add all the campaigns and modes from the previous two games to make it a giant Hitman hub. If had to choose one 'desert island' game to play forever, it would be this. It's huge and there's endless stuff to do.

Their bundles are a bit confusing but I think the starter pack is the free one. That gives you the training level, and I think they sometimes unlock various other levels to try. Then there's the 'part one' bundle you quoted, which is the content from Hitman 1 plus its campaign expansion.

The one you really want is the standard edition, which includes everything from all three games bar a couple of bonus levels. All the bundles effectively download the entire game, and you can pay to unlock bits of it later if you like it. Even the £2.49 version is hundreds of hours of gameplay.
